Who is Fouad Ajami?

Fouad A. Ajami, is a MacArthur Fellowship winning, Lebanese-born American university professor and writer on Middle Eastern issues. He is currently a senior fellow at Stanford University's Hoover Institution.

Ajami was an outspoken supporter of the Iraq War, about the nobility of which he believes there "can be no doubt".
